Air Force Junior Rotc Leadership Camp Comes to Baylor

June 16, 1999

WACO, Texas -- High school students from throughout Texas will come together as Baylor University hosts the Air Force Junior ROTC Leadership Camp June 21-27.
The leadership camp, sponsored by Temple High School, is open to both male and female students ages 14-18. There will be various seminars during the afternoons, which will focus on teaching students to reach deep into their heart to unlock their potential.
There also will be different guests and speakers, including an Air Force recruiter. The camp will be set up much like a boot camp. There will be numerous activities, such as drills, drill competitions, running, marching, softball, volleyball, basketball, flag football and much more. Students will be divided into units which will compete against each other. There also will be a leadership reaction course, similar to an obstacle course, at the end of the week. It will allow students an opportunity to implement leadership and teamwork skills they have acquired during the week.
There also will be several field trips during the week, including an airplane demonstration at Fort Hood. At the end of the week, students will participate in a parade and will receive graduation certificates.
The cost of the camp is $202 per participant, which includes meals and lodging on the Baylor campus.
